Forward Guidance
As no recent earnings results have been released, ChimeraPrefA (CIM^A) has not published any new forward guidance tied to quarterly financial performance in the current reporting window. The fixed coupon structure of the Series A preferred stock means that scheduled distributions are tied to the stated 8.00% rate per the security’s offering terms, unless the issuer announces adjustments to redemption plans or other structural changes, and no such announcements have been made alongside quarterly earnings updates in the current period. Analysts tracking the preferred stock space note that guidance for fixed-income securities like CIM^A often ties more closely to broader interest rate environments and the parent company’s overall liquidity position, rather than quarterly operational results, but no new formal outlook statements from the issuer are available at this time. Any potential shifts to the security’s terms would likely be announced in a formal regulatory filing, separate from standard quarterly earnings releases in many cases.
